They hide their unattractive qualities beneath beautiful, light, and dreamy appearances. Read the excerpt from The Great Gatsby. WebJay Gatsby Character Analysis. The title character of The Great Gatsby is a young man, around thirty years old, who rose from an impoverished childhood in rural North Dakota to become fabulously wealthy. However, he achieved this lofty goal by participating in organized crime, including distributing illegal alcohol and trading in stolen securities.

East egg is a setting in the novel “The Great Gatsby” where the people in wealthy communities with family fortunes and “old money” lived. It was more fashionable. West egg was the place where people with “new money” who had recently become wealthy lived.
